  3. MYTIISHI SHOOTING UPDATE (LOW PRIORITY, RUSSIAN SOURCE):

    • TASS (16:36 UTC) reports four people were injured in the Mytishchi shopping center shooting, all in moderate condition. ASTRA (16:50 UTC) provides more detail, claiming the shooter was denied entry for refusing a bag check, used pepper spray, left, and returned with a traumatic pistol. A criminal case for hooliganism has been opened.
    • Assessment: This is a CRIMINAL INCIDENT, NOT DIRECTLY RELATED to the UKRAINE CONFLICT. It DOES NOT IMPACT the MILITARY SITUATION.

  7. UKRAINE MAY CONSIDER TERRITORIAL CONCESSIONS (HIGH PRIORITY, MULTIPLE SOURCES):

    • ТАСС (16:44 UTC) and ЦАПЛІЄНКО_UKRAINE FIGHTS (16:51 UTC) quote Trump advisor Waltz saying Ukraine may consider territorial concessions in exchange for security guarantees, with Europe leading the guarantees. РБК-Україна (16:57 UTC) quotes US Secretary of State Rubio saying cooperation will resume when Ukraine is ready for peace, and that security guarantees should come AFTER peace.
    • Assessment: This is a SIGNIFICANT SHIFT in the DISCUSSION AROUND A POTENTIAL SETTLEMENT. The SUGGESTION OF TERRITORIAL CONCESSIONS is a MAJOR DEPARTURE from UKRAINE'S PREVIOUS STANCE. The DISAGREEMENT between WALTZ AND RUBIO on the TIMING OF SECURITY GUARANTEES highlights INTERNAL DIVISIONS within the US ADMINISTRATION on the BEST APPROACH TO THE CONFLICT.
